It would be nice for through traffic between I-65 north and I-24 east and I-40 west to have a bypass since there is a lot of truck traffic from I-65 going towards Memphis and Atlanta, but Briley Parkway could be used for that purpose. The western segment is underutilized at the moment, and a lot of that is probably due to the lack of signage directing through traffic to use it. Upgrading Briley south to I-24 would help a lot to remove through traffic from the downtown area, too.
If I recall, I think part of the reasoning behind shelving it was due to environmental concerns. You are crossing the Cumberland River twice, and traversing more difficult terrain. It took a long time to finish TN 840 in western Williamson County partly due to that reason.
